Switzerland to italy - The connected resorts of Zermatt and Breuil-Cervinia in Italy comprise the highest ski resorts in Switzerland, with the highest slope sitting at a sky-high 12,792 (3,899 meters). You’ll find around 223.7 miles (360 kilometers) of pistes in Zermatt, with the majority of those rated red, so best-suited for experienced skiers.

Switzerland is one of Italy's most important trading partners. In 2021, Switzerland exported goods worth US$13.2 billion to Italy and imported goods worth US$32.2 billion, resulting in a total trade volume of US$45.4 billion. Mar 1, 2018 · Italy is one of the largest European countries in the Mediterranean and has a land border that stretches 1,116 miles in length. France, Switzerland, Austria, and Slovenia are the four countries that share a land border with Italy. Of these countries, Switzerland shares the longest land border with Italy that stretches 434 miles in length, while ... The 15,003 m (49,222 ft) Gotthard Rail Tunnel, close to but separate from the expressway tunnel, handles rail traffic on the north-south line in Switzerland. It was opened in 1882, at the time the world's longest tunnel, though later superseded by longer tunnels, some over 50 km (31 mi) long. Under construction since 2002 and opened on 1 June ... Switzerland come …May 18, 2023 · The Bernina Express train route from Switzerland to Italy is one of the most spectacular train journeys anywhere in the world. The little red train winds its way through forests, meadows, gorges and mountain villages, and alongside waterfalls, lakes and glaciers on its way from Chur in Switzerland to Tirano, just over the border in Italy. Crossing the border was easy!A short bus ride connected us from our Airbnb in the village of Argegno to the Como San Giovanni station on the outskirts of Como.From there, the …Dec 17, 2017 · On the journey from Geneva to Milan, the EuroCity trains make six intermediate stops – four in Switzerland and two in Italy. To see the best scenery, sit on the right hand side of the train on the first part of the journey out of Geneva, switching to the left side while in the Simplon Tunnel. By train. Train, SBB, Winter, Zentralschweiz. Switzerland is within easy reach from Italy. The EuroCity train line has numerous daily connections from Milan to major Swiss cities such as Basel, Berne, Geneva, Lausanne, Lucerne, Lugano and Zurich.
